What do you do with 30 crystal candelabra, more than 4000 peonies, roses, carnations and hydrangeas and 72 boxes of diamante pins? You transform the ballroom at the Grosvenor House Hotel into a glittering setting for an Indian wedding naturally!!!. For the escort card table we created a carpet of 1500 carnations in every shade of pink, which stretched am amazing 12 feet!

For the tables which were dressed with gold silk cloths, we created wonderful flower boxes covered with peonies, hydrangeas and roses, which made perfect bases for the crystal candelabra. So, what about all those diamante pins? We used them to highlight every single rose in every single arrangement!! The glamour continued with the menu cards which were especially made in the Philippines in pink and gold brocade.

The bride and groom were the centre of attention with luscious garlands on the backs of their chairs; and the stage was flanked with a pair of fabulous gold urns for even more impact!

The meticulous planning of wedding coordinator Amanda Sherlock from Giles Sherlock Event Design made this a truly spectacular event, which was captured in all it’s glory by photographer Gill Flett

On what turned out to be a gloriously sunny day a few weeks ago, we set off for the wedding of Rachel and
James at the elegant

Stoke Park Club
With glorious views across the surrounding parkland, guests enjoyed a champagne reception on the terrace, before the wedding breakfast in the regency Wyatt room. Our classic champagne flute vases filled with hydrangeas, roses and scented freesias ( a favourite of the bride ) in soft pinks and creams set the tone for this most elegant of formal receptions.
A touch of whimsy was added by decorating the beautiful silver gilt “epergnes” with hydrangeas and roses, so that they almost looked like gorgeous edible arrangements!
